Position Summary

We are seeking a qualified, enthusiastic, and Christ-centered High School Science Teacher to teach Life Science or Physical Science Courses. The ideal candidate will inspire students to explore God’s creation through the study of science, integrating a biblical worldview into instruction. This role involves teaching a range of science courses, conducting lab experiences and preparing students for academic success and spiritual growth.

Key Responsibilities

Spiritual Leadership

  • Model Christ-like character and behavior in and out of the classroom.
  • Integrate biblical principles and a Christian worldview into science instruction.
  • Encourage students in their spiritual journey through prayer, devotions, and faith-based discussions.

Instructional Responsibilities

  • Plan, prepare, and deliver engaging lessons in science subjects of Life Science or Physical Sciences Courses.
  • Develop a curriculum that aligns with academic standards while reflecting the school’s Christian values.
  • Direct students in hands-on experiments, labs, and technology to enhance student understanding and engagement.
  • Assess and monitor student progress through tests, projects, labs, and other evaluation methods.
  • Differentiate instruction to meet the diverse needs of learners.

Classroom Management

  • Foster a well-organized classroom and Christ-centered learning environment.
  • Implement effective classroom management strategies that encourage student accountability and collaboration.
  • Ensure the safety of students during lab activities by following appropriate procedures and guidelines.

Collaboration and Communication

  • Maintain open and effective communication with students, parents, and colleagues.
  • Collaborate with other faculty members to integrate faith and learning across subjects.
  • Participate in parent-teacher conferences, school meetings, and professional learning communities.

Professional Development

  • Stay current with advancements in science education and pedagogical best practices.
  • Participate in professional development opportunities, workshops, and training sessions.

Additional Responsibilities

  • Assist with extracurricular activities, such as science fairs, STEM clubs, or other student programs.
  • Support school-wide events, such as chapel services, mission projects, and community outreach.
  • Perform other duties as assigned by school leadership.

Qualifications

Spiritual and Personal

  • A committed Christian with a vibrant faith and a passion for mentoring students in their spiritual and academic journey.
  • Agreement with the school’s statement of faith and mission.

Educational and Professional

  • Bachelor’s degree in Science Education, Life or Physical Sciences, or a related field (required).
  • Teaching certification (State or ACSI certification)
  • Experience teaching high school science, preferably in a Christian or faith-based school setting.
